Nature's Abode

First and foremost, the town's natural beauty is an undeniable draw. The expansive Zwin Nature Park showcases a rich tapestry of bird species, tidal marshes, and a dynamic saltwater ecosystem. This meeting point of sea, land, and sky serves as a crucial stopover for migratory birds and is a testament to the importance of preserving nature even in our rapidly urbanizing world.

Knokke-Heist's beaches, stretching over 12 kilometers, are not just spots to bask under the sun; they are venues of serenity, where the rhythm of the waves lulls visitors into a tranquil state of mind.

Cultural Capital

While its natural wonders are captivating, Knokke-Heist is far from a sleepy beach town. It pulses with a vibrant arts scene, frequently hosting exhibitions, music festivals, and cultural events. The Sculpture Garden, for instance, offers a unique blend of nature and art, where visitors can marvel at masterpieces set against a backdrop of verdant greenery and the distant murmur of the sea.

Luxury Meets Leisure

The town has earned its reputation as Belgium's "Monaco of the North." The upscale boutiques and galleries lining the Lippenslaan and Kustlaan, the array of fine dining options, and the glamorous casino imbue the town with a sophisticated aura. Visitors seeking a luxurious experience will find it in the town's posh villas, top-tier restaurants, and chic shops.

A Community Spirit

Yet, beyond its glitz and glamour, Knokke-Heist remains rooted in community values. Annual events, like the International Fireworks Festival, knit locals and visitors together in shared awe and delight. The bustling markets, intimate cafes, and community-led initiatives ensure that despite its upscale reputation, Knokke-Heist retains a warm and welcoming spirit.

Bruges: The Timeless Beauty of Belgium

Bruges, often referred to as the 'Venice of the North,' is a place where time seems to stand still. With its meandering canals, medieval architecture, and cobbled streets, this Belgian city offers a journey back to a bygone era.

Every corner of Bruges is a testament to its rich history. The Market Square, crowned with the iconic Belfry, has been the heart of city life for centuries. Climb its steps, and you're rewarded with a panoramic view that stretches across the terracotta rooftops, punctuated by church spires and historic landmarks.
